Avatar billede avon Nybegynder
01. august 2003 - 12:18 Der er 6 kommentarer og
1 løsning

afslut session med inet

Jeg bruger en Internet Trasnfer Control til at kontakte en webside som sætter en session-variabel.
Jeg vil gerne kunne lukke inet ned så jeg efterfølgende kan kontakte siden uden at den gamle session-variabel stadig er aktiv.
Jeg har forsøgt med:
inet.execute, "close"
inet.execute, "quit"
inet.cancel
, men uden held.

Nogle forslag?
Avatar billede overchord Nybegynder
01. august 2003 - 12:26 #1
check denne side for referencer:
http://msdn.microsoft.com/library/default.asp?url=/workshop/browser/webbrowser/reflist_vb.asp

Du skal vist bruge inet.execute, "stop"
Avatar billede overchord Nybegynder
01. august 2003 - 12:28 #2
Men det kommer lidt an paa hvordan du har sat ie op. Check dette eksempel ogsaa da det starter fra bunden med at skabe ie sesion:

http://www-rcf.usc.edu/~anthonyb/itp150/internet/internet.htm
Avatar billede avon Nybegynder
01. august 2003 - 12:45 #3
Det er IKKE en webBrowser-control jeg bruger, men en Internet Transfer Control(Inet).
Så vidt jeg kan se burde det være
inet.execute ,"QUIT"
men selv om jegudfører denne kommando, stopper projektet og starter det igen, så har inet-controllen stadig den gamle session-variabel. Kan det måske være at den ikke sletter session-cookie'en?
Avatar billede hiks Nybegynder
01. august 2003 - 13:32 #4
har du prøvet at sætte din control lig nothing når du unloader programmet eller klikket er hvilken event du udfører?

set inet = nothing

/hiks
Avatar billede avon Nybegynder
01. august 2003 - 13:50 #5
inet-controllen ligger på en form (form1.inet1)
Hvis jeg skriver Set Form1.inet1 = Nothing får jeg "Invalid use of property"
Da den ligger på formen har jeg jo heller ikke dim'et den (Dim foo as new inet)
Avatar billede overchord Nybegynder
01. august 2003 - 17:26 #6
Proev at kigge paa denne side. Det er ikke helt hvad du leder efter, men maaske kan det hjaelpe. Kan ikke finde nogen dokumentation der naevner lukning af kontrollen.....

http://support.microsoft.com/default.aspx?scid=kb;en-us;174836
Avatar billede avon Nybegynder
01. februar 2005 - 13:31 #7
Jeg bruger nu winsock i stedet, da man her selv kan styre om session-cookie skal sendes emd eller ej.
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ester